Неправильное поведение запроса IBM Optim Insert
Я новичок здесь и в мире IBM Optim, поэтому я надеюсь, что здесь есть кто-то, кто работал с IBM Optim.
Вот проблема:
У меня есть производственная и тестовая среда базы данных. В моей производственной базе данных у меня есть несколько пользователей (приблизительно 100), и я сделал запрос на извлечение из этой базы данных, включая PK, синонимы, пакеты и т. Д.
Моя проблема, когда я пытаюсь выполнить запрос вставки этого извлечения. В редакторе карт таблиц я установил источник квалификатора (MAIAR.SISCEL) и пункт назначения классификатора (DB_REPORTS.MS_OPTIM, где MS_OPTIM - это пользователь в моей целевой базе данных). Проблема в том, что большинство объектов, извлеченных из производственной базы данных, принадлежат разным пользователям, но когда я пытаюсь вставить этот объект в целевую базу данных, запрос на вставку изменяет имя исходного объекта, получая клонированный объект у конечного пользователя. (MS_OPTIM).
Например, у меня есть объект синонима TC_SISCEL.PG_SYNONYM, но когда объект вставляется в базу данных назначения, он переименовывается в MS_OPTIM.PG_SYNONYM. И это не работает для меня. Мне нужно скопировать объект с тем же именем, которое я извлек из моей производственной базы данных.
Пожалуйста, кто-нибудь, помогите мне! Я пытался решить эту проблему почти неделю без решения.
Заранее спасибо. Сами